
Banking up a coal fire is a practical technique used to keep a fire burning slowly and efficiently overnight or for extended periods without constant attention. It involves arranging the coal in a specific way to control combustion, ensuring the fire remains smoldering rather than burning out completely. By raking the hot coals to the center, adding a thin layer of fresh coal, and then covering it with a light layer of ash, the fire’s oxygen supply is reduced, allowing it to burn at a lower temperature. This method not only preserves the fire but also helps maintain warmth and reduces the need for frequent refueling, making it a valuable skill for homeowners and those relying on coal-fired heating systems.

Prepare the Fireplace: Clean ashes, check ventilation, and ensure the grate is properly positioned for optimal burning
Before banking up a coal fire, it's essential to prepare the fireplace to ensure a safe and efficient burn. Start by cleaning out the ashes from the previous fire. Excessive ash can restrict airflow, hindering combustion. Use a fireplace shovel to remove cold ashes, leaving a thin layer (about 1 inch) to act as insulation and promote better burning. Dispose of the ashes in a metal container, as they can remain hot for hours and pose a fire risk. Once cleaned, inspect the fireplace for any debris or obstructions that could interfere with the fire’s performance.
Next, check the ventilation of the fireplace to ensure proper airflow. Open the damper fully to allow smoke and gases to escape up the chimney. If the damper is stuck or damaged, address the issue before proceeding, as poor ventilation can lead to smoke filling the room or incomplete combustion. Additionally, ensure the chimney is clear of blockages, such as bird nests or creosote buildup. If you’re unsure, consider having a professional chimney sweep inspect and clean it to guarantee optimal airflow.
Proper positioning of the grate is crucial for banking up a coal fire effectively. The grate should be centered in the fireplace and elevated to allow air to circulate freely beneath the fuel. If your grate is adjustable, position it so that the coal bed sits at least 2 inches above the fireplace floor. This elevation ensures adequate oxygen supply to the fire, promoting a hotter and more sustained burn. A well-positioned grate also helps in distributing heat evenly and prevents the coal from smothering due to poor airflow.
After cleaning the ashes, checking ventilation, and positioning the grate, inspect the fireplace for any remaining preparations. Ensure the hearth is clear of flammable materials, and the area around the fireplace is safe. If using a fireplace screen, position it securely to prevent embers from escaping. These steps not only optimize the burning conditions for banking up the coal fire but also enhance safety and efficiency, setting the stage for a long-lasting and warm fire.

Choose Quality Coal: Select dry, high-grade coal with low impurities for a longer-lasting and efficient fire
When it comes to banking up a coal fire, the quality of the coal you choose plays a pivotal role in determining the fire's longevity and efficiency. Select dry, high-grade coal with low impurities as your first step. Moisture in coal can significantly hinder its ability to burn efficiently, as the fire’s energy is wasted evaporating water instead of producing heat. Dry coal ignites more easily and burns hotter, ensuring a consistent and sustained fire. High-grade coal, often referred to as anthracite or bituminous coal, has a higher carbon content, which translates to a longer burn time and more heat output. This type of coal also produces less smoke and ash, making it cleaner and more environmentally friendly compared to lower-grade alternatives.
Impurities in coal, such as sulfur, clay, or rocks, can negatively impact the fire’s performance and the overall experience. Sulfur, for instance, not only emits a foul odor when burned but also contributes to corrosion in your fireplace or stove. Coal with low impurities ensures a cleaner burn, reducing the buildup of creosote in chimneys and minimizing maintenance needs. When purchasing coal, look for products labeled as "low-sulfur" or "premium grade" to guarantee a higher-quality fuel source. Investing in better coal may cost more upfront, but it pays off in the long run through improved efficiency and reduced waste.
The size and consistency of the coal pieces also matter. Choose coal that is uniformly sized, typically ranging from 1 to 2 inches in diameter, as this allows for better airflow and even combustion. Larger lumps of coal tend to burn more slowly and steadily, making them ideal for banking a fire overnight or for extended periods. Avoid coal that crumbles easily or contains excessive dust, as this can lead to uneven burning and a messier fire. High-quality coal should feel solid and heavy for its size, indicating a high density and energy content.
Storing your coal properly is equally important to maintain its quality. Keep it in a dry, well-ventilated area, preferably in a sealed container, to prevent moisture absorption from the air. Wet coal not only burns poorly but can also lead to a smoky, inefficient fire. If you notice your coal has become damp, spread it out to dry before use, though it may never regain its full efficiency. By prioritizing dry, high-grade coal with minimal impurities, you set the foundation for a fire that is easier to bank, burns longer, and provides more consistent heat.
Finally, sourcing your coal from reputable suppliers ensures you get the quality you need. Local fireplace stores or trusted online vendors often carry premium coal options and can provide guidance on the best type for your specific needs. While it may be tempting to opt for cheaper, lower-grade coal, the benefits of using high-quality fuel—such as reduced maintenance, cleaner burning, and prolonged heat—far outweigh the initial cost. By choosing the right coal, you not only enhance the efficiency of your fire but also contribute to a safer and more enjoyable heating experience.

Control Airflow: Adjust dampers and vents to regulate oxygen supply, maintaining a steady and controlled burn
Controlling airflow is a critical aspect of banking up a coal fire effectively. The primary goal is to regulate the oxygen supply to maintain a steady and controlled burn, ensuring the fire remains alive but at a lower intensity. Start by locating the dampers and vents on your coal stove or fireplace. Dampers are typically found in the chimney or flue and control the overall airflow, while vents are usually located on the stove itself and manage the air entering the combustion chamber. Proper adjustment of these components allows you to fine-tune the oxygen supply, which directly impacts the fire’s intensity. Begin by partially closing the damper to restrict the flow of air up the chimney, which helps retain heat and slows the burn rate. Simultaneously, adjust the vents to reduce the amount of air entering the firebox, ensuring the coal continues to smolder without flaring up.
When adjusting the dampers, it’s essential to strike a balance. Closing the damper too much can starve the fire of oxygen, causing it to extinguish, while leaving it too open will result in a hotter, faster burn that consumes the coal quickly. Aim for a position that allows a minimal but consistent flow of air up the chimney. This helps maintain a low, steady temperature that keeps the coals glowing without fanning the flames. Experiment with small adjustments, waiting a few minutes between each change to observe the fire’s response. Over time, you’ll develop a sense of the optimal damper position for banking your specific coal fire.
Vents play an equally important role in controlling airflow. Most coal stoves have both primary and secondary air vents. The primary vent supplies air directly to the coal bed, while the secondary vent introduces air above the combustion zone to ensure complete burning of gases. When banking a fire, partially close the primary air vent to reduce the oxygen supply to the coals, slowing the burn rate. Leave the secondary vent slightly open to ensure any remaining gases burn off cleanly, preventing smoke and creosote buildup. This combination of reduced primary air and minimal secondary air creates the ideal conditions for a banked fire.
Monitoring the fire’s behavior as you adjust the dampers and vents is crucial. A properly banked coal fire should have a faint, steady glow with minimal visible flame. If the fire appears to be dying out, slightly open the damper or primary vent to increase oxygen flow. Conversely, if the fire becomes too active, close the vents further to reduce the air supply. Patience and observation are key, as it may take several adjustments to achieve the perfect balance. Remember, the goal is to create a self-sustaining smolder that will last for hours without constant attention.
Finally, consider the type of coal you’re burning, as it can influence how you control airflow. Anthracite coal, for example, burns more slowly and requires less oxygen than bituminous coal. Adjust your damper and vent settings accordingly, keeping in mind the natural burn characteristics of your fuel. By mastering the art of controlling airflow through dampers and vents, you’ll be able to bank up a coal fire efficiently, ensuring it remains alive and ready to reignite when needed while conserving fuel and maintaining a consistent heat output.

Bank the Fire: Cover the coal with a thin layer of ash to preserve heat overnight or for extended periods
Banking a coal fire is a time-honored technique used to preserve heat overnight or for extended periods, ensuring the fire remains dormant yet ready to reignite when needed. The key to successfully banking a fire lies in covering the hot coals with a thin, even layer of ash. This method acts as an insulator, trapping the residual heat within the coal bed while minimizing oxygen flow, which slows down combustion. By doing so, the fire’s core remains warm, allowing it to be easily revived with fresh fuel when required. This process is particularly useful in traditional fireplaces or coal stoves, where maintaining a consistent heat source is essential.
To begin banking the fire, first ensure the coals are hot and glowing but not actively burning with flames. Use a poker or fireplace tool to gently spread the coals into an even layer across the firebed. This step is crucial, as it maximizes the surface area of the coals, enabling the ash layer to insulate them more effectively. Avoid stirring the coals excessively, as this can introduce oxygen and reignite the fire prematurely. Once the coals are evenly distributed, allow them to settle for a few minutes to ensure they are at the right temperature for banking.
Next, carefully shovel a thin layer of ash over the coals, ensuring complete coverage. The ash acts as a natural insulator, trapping the heat within the coal bed while also cutting off the oxygen supply, which slows down the burning process. Be mindful not to smother the coals with too much ash, as this can extinguish the fire entirely. A layer approximately 1-2 inches thick is usually sufficient. Use a gentle hand to avoid disturbing the coals, as the goal is to preserve their heat, not to extinguish them.
After covering the coals with ash, close the damper partially to restrict airflow into the fireplace or stove. This further reduces oxygen supply, helping the coals retain their heat for a longer period. However, avoid closing the damper completely, as some minimal airflow is still necessary to prevent the buildup of harmful gases. If using a stove, ensure the vents are adjusted to a low setting to maintain a controlled environment. This combination of ash insulation and reduced airflow creates the ideal conditions for banking the fire.
Finally, leave the fire undisturbed overnight or for the desired period. When you’re ready to revive the fire, simply remove the ash layer, add small pieces of kindling or fresh coal, and gently blow on the coals to reintroduce oxygen. The residual heat from the banked coals will quickly reignite the fire, providing warmth without the need to start from scratch. Banking a coal fire is a practical and efficient method for maintaining heat, especially in colder climates or during extended periods of inactivity. With proper technique, it ensures a reliable and convenient heat source whenever needed.
